Teeth whitening?

ok this is the story. i got my teeth bleached (and they did the shittiest job. like seriously my teeth have white and yellow splotches. anyways the question is...can i brush my teeth now? i got it done yesterday. they told me no coffee and no mouth wash. but isnt mouth wash almost like brushing your teeth?

Teeth whitening?
Blotchiness is not an uncommon phenomenon with whitening and is usually temporary. It generally happens because the tooth becomes a bit dehydrated (which is a normal part of the process) and the spots will usually go away once the tooth has been fully rehydrated. You can brush your teeth now, but I would guess that they don%26#039;t want you using a rinse (or coffee, tea, wine, soda, smoking) because the %26quot;pores%26quot; of the teeth have been opened up to remove the stain which has left them open to getting more stain in, if exposed to it. I would give them a call for a follow up if it doesn%26#039;t resolve.
